The Main Topic: Uncontested Divorce Mediation
Uncontested divorce mediation is a process where parties in a divorce agreement voluntarily resolve their differences and come to an agreement without the need for a traditional lawyer. This approach can be particularly useful when both parties have agreed on all major issues or are simply looking to minimize conflict.
How Uncontested Divorce Mediation Works
Here's a step-by-step overview of the uncontested divorce mediation process:
- First, both parties will have an initial meeting to discuss their goals and expectations for the mediation process.
- Next, each party will have the opportunity to review the other's financial documents, including assets, debts, and income.
- A mediator will then facilitate a discussion between the parties, aiming to identify any agreements or compromises that can be reached through negotiation.
- Throughout the process, both parties may also participate in group discussions and decision-making activities to help reach a mutually acceptable agreement.
The Benefits of Uncontested Divorce Mediation
Uncontested divorce mediation offers several key benefits, including:
- Cost savings: By avoiding the need for a lawyer, parties can save on attorney fees.
- Less stress and more control: Uncontested divorce mediation allows parties to take an active role in resolving their issues, reducing stress and promoting control over their divorce process.
- Improved communication: The mediator will facilitate open and honest communication between the parties, helping to resolve any disputes or issues that may arise.
